Volkswagen approves deep cuts to lineup and headcount
Volkswagen’s Supervisory Board unanimously approved the executive committee’s Future Plan 2030 on September 3, launching a sweeping operational overhaul aimed at improving corporate profitability. The automaker plans to eliminate 50,000 jobs across its global operations by 2030, with management positions included in the staff reductions. The plan targets an annual sales volume of nine million vehicles and an operating margin of 9 percent. 1
To meet those financial metrics, Volkswagen will reduce its model portfolio by 50 percent and cut offering complexity across remaining nameplates by 75 percent. Company leadership cited intense competitive pressure from domestic automakers in China and substantial excess manufacturing capacity across European facilities. European plant capacity currently exceeds regional vehicle demand by more than 500,000 units annually. 1
Production runs at German manufacturing sites in Emden, Zwickau, Hanover, and Neckarsulm—which build vehicles including the ID.3, ID.4, ID.Buzz, and Audi A5—face reassessment and are unlikely to continue in their current form through 2034. In North America, the group plans to concentrate engineering resources and product offerings on its most profitable SUV and truck segments. 1
RivianOS 2 rolls out to original R1 trucks
Rivian began transmitting its new vehicle operating interface, named RivianOS 2, to existing R1S sport utility vehicles and R1T pickup trucks through over-the-air software update version 2026.31. The update brings the visual layout and menu organization originally created for the smaller R2 platform into the brand’s first-generation models. Owners receive reconfigurable center-display control panes, dynamic shortcuts that adapt to current driving conditions, and a revised search tool within the vehicle settings menu. 2

The update integrates Google Maps route alerts into the primary navigation system, displaying real-time speed camera notices and crowd-sourced hazard warnings. Subscribers to the Connect+ connected-services tier gain a live weather application and mobile trip management that syncs between the vehicle display and the Rivian smartphone app. While the graphical presentation remains unified across model lines, hardware differences remain. First-generation R1 vehicles utilize cloud-based processing for voice assistance and retain traditional steering-wheel buttons, whereas R2 models carry integrated infotainment processors capable of executing voice commands offline alongside dual haptic scroll wheels. 2
Stellantis pushes back its extended-range Jeep and Ram trucks
Stellantis has delayed the production debuts of two key series plug-in hybrid models, according to supplier reports confirmed by Car and Driver. The Jeep Grand Wagoneer Hybrid, originally scheduled to commence assembly in May, is now scheduled for a November production launch. The Ram 1500 REV—previously announced as the Ramcharger before the brand canceled its companion battery-electric pickup—has slipped from late 2025 into mid-April, with retail deliveries targeted for 2027. 3

Supplier representatives reported that engineers requested additional development time to validate the extended-range architecture under high load and towing conditions. Both vehicles share a mechanical layout pairing a 400-volt traction battery with a 3.6-liter Pentastar V-6 engine. The internal combustion engine operates exclusively as a mechanical generator, sending electricity to the battery pack and electric drive motors without any direct physical connection to the drive wheels. Ram stated that customer arrivals remain on track for the 2027 calendar year, while Jeep affirmed its intent to commence customer builds this winter. 3

The Alcan 5000 proves you do not need a monster truck for the Arctic
The 2026 summer edition of the Alcan 5000 rally got underway this week, sending dozens of automotive enthusiasts on a 5,000-mile endurance journey spanning northern British Columbia, the Yukon, and Alaska. The route covers remote gravel ribbons and isolated highways where distances between fuel stations routinely stretch beyond 200 miles, with single driving legs reaching up to 820 miles. 4

European luxury sport utility vehicles formed the largest contingent on the entry roster, led by four Porsche Cayennes and two Volkswagen Touaregs. Participant Brad Brownell reported that his 2013 Cayenne Diesel easily completes 700 miles per tank, allowing drivers to finish grueling driving days on a single fuel stop while riding on aftermarket skid plates and high-sidewall all-terrain tires. A new Ineos Grenadier and a BMW X5 also joined the convoy. Heavy American machinery tackled the route as well, including a lifted Ford F-350 Super Duty Tremor, a 1,000-horsepower Hennessey VelociraptoR, a factory Bronco Raptor, and a Toyota Tundra support truck. Due to elevated fuel consumption, several truck crews resorted to auxiliary bed-mounted fuel jugs between remote outposts. 4
Everyday crossover vehicles proved equally capable of handling the northern public roads. Entrants fielded a front-wheel-drive Honda Pilot on steel wheels, a Volkswagen Golf TDI, and a skid-plate-equipped Subaru Forester Wilderness driven by veteran competitors Andy and Mercedes Lilienthal. Four adventure motorcyclists completed the roster, traveling self-contained with spare parts and auxiliary fuel strapped to their luggage racks. 4
Laguna Seca caps the IndyCar season as 2027 seats shake out
The NTT IndyCar Series concluded its 2026 championship calendar at WeatherTech Raceway Laguna Seca with the Mission Foods Grand Prix of Monterey. Chip Ganassi Racing driver Alex Palou arrived in California having already clinched his fourth consecutive drivers’ championship and fifth title overall at the Milwaukee Mile, allowing the title contenders to focus entirely on race execution. Team Penske’s Scott McLaughlin captured the pole position—marking the 250th IndyCar pole for Chevrolet—before driving to victory on the 2.238-mile natural road course. 5

The finale triggered major driver announcements for the 2027 season. Meyer Shank Racing confirmed the signing of Mick Schumacher to pilot its No. 66 Honda alongside returning driver Marcus Armstrong, filling the seat vacated by 2026 Indianapolis 500 winner Felix Rosenqvist, who departs for Arrow McLaren. Dreyer & Reinbold Racing announced a full-time series return for 2027 backed by Honda engines, signing 34-year-old series veteran Conor Daly to a multi-year contract in the No. 24 entry. DRR purchased an IndyCar team charter from Rahal Letterman Lanigan Racing in July, securing its place on the grid after competing primarily as an Indianapolis 500 specialist since 2012. 5
Explainer: how EV batteries really charge, degrade, and hold up
Electric vehicle battery packs represent the single most expensive and technically demanding sub-assembly in modern electrified personal transport, accounting for 30 to 40 percent of a vehicle’s manufacturing bill of materials. While consumer electronics rely on single lithium-ion cells running at approximately 3.7 to 4.2 volts, an automotive traction battery connects hundreds or thousands of individual cells in series and parallel arrangements to deliver 400 to 800 volts of direct current. 6

Automakers in the United States rely primarily on two lithium-ion cathode chemistries, each presenting distinct engineering trade-offs:
- Nickel Manganese Cobalt (NMC): NMC cells deliver high gravimetric and volumetric energy density, storing more energy per pound of pack weight. They perform well in sub-freezing winter temperatures and discharge power rapidly for brisk acceleration. Raw material costs remain elevated due to cobalt and nickel extraction, and the cells experience thermal stress when charged continuously to maximum voltage.
- Lithium Iron Phosphate (LFP): LFP packs replace scarce cobalt and nickel with abundant iron and phosphate compounds. The chemistry tolerates high operating temperatures, provides longer overall cycle life, and costs less to manufacture. Energy density is roughly 20 to 30 percent lower than NMC, leading to heavier packs for equivalent range, and chemical reaction rates slow significantly in sub-zero winter weather.
Recharging these chemical reservoirs involves three distinct tiers of electrical delivery. Level 1 charging operates from a household 120-volt alternating-current outlet, adding 3 to 5 miles of range per hour of connection. Level 2 charging utilizes 240-volt residential or 208-volt commercial AC power, supplying between 7 and 19 kilowatts through an onboard inverter to fully charge a depleted pack overnight in 6 to 10 hours. 6
Level 3 direct-current fast charging bypasses the onboard vehicle inverter entirely, feeding high-amperage DC power straight into the battery pack at rates between 50 and 350 kilowatts. Charging speed follows an electronic curve controlled by the vehicle’s battery management system rather than a flat line. Cold ambient temperatures, elevated internal resistance, and station load-sharing reduce initial power intake. Once the pack reaches approximately 80 percent state of charge, the vehicle computer sharply curtails incoming current to prevent lithium plating and excessive heat generation. As a result, replenishing the final 20 percent of capacity frequently requires as much time as charging from 10 to 80 percent. 6
Longevity differs fundamentally from consumer electronics. A smartphone battery endures 300 to 500 complete discharge cycles before capacity drops to 80 percent, typically degrading within two years of daily replenishment. Electric vehicles experience shallower charge-discharge cycles because drivers rarely drain packs to zero. Federal regulations require automotive manufacturers to warranty EV traction batteries for a minimum of eight years or 100,000 miles, guaranteeing that the pack retains at least 70 percent of original energy capacity. Many automakers exceed this threshold, offering 10-year or 175,000-mile warranty coverage. Routine software limits that cap daily AC charging at 80 percent state of charge prevent cathode saturation, preserving cell stability over decades of service. 6

A 2JZ-swapped 1971 El Camino brings Japanese boost to American steel
A custom 1971 Chevrolet El Camino currently listed on Hagerty Marketplace illustrates how builder culture continues to dissolve traditional boundaries between American muscle cars and Japanese tuner platforms. Rather than housing a Chevrolet 396 or 454 big-block V-8 beneath its sheet metal, this third-generation utility coupe features a Toyota 2JZ-GTE VVT-i 3.0-liter turbocharged inline-six engine originally made famous by the Mk IV Toyota Supra. 7

Originally built by XAT Racing for the All Supra Show, the powertrain conversion replaced the factory sequential twin-turbo configuration with a Precision 6766 single turbocharger fitted with a high-flow inlet horn. Fuel and air delivery upgrades include a Royal Chamber intake manifold, Injector Dynamics ID1000 fuel injectors, a Fuelab pressure regulator, and an electronic fuel-injection system fed by a 450-liter-per-hour fuel pump. 7
The exterior is finished in House of Kolors Burgundy Wine paint over black multi-spoke wheels, retaining factory chrome bumpers, SS grille badging, and a functional open pickup bed. The seller noted minor paint imperfections and localized rust bubbles, yet the mechanical conversion pairs Japanese turbocharger response with American rear-wheel-drive proportions. 7

The secret salvage yard that dismantled 122 brand-new C8 Corvettes
In December 2021, an EF-2 tornado swept across Kentucky, striking General Motors’ Bowling Green Assembly facility and sparking a fire inside the plant. At the time, customer demand for the newly introduced mid-engine C8 Corvette Stingray was at its peak, with buyers waiting months on dealership allocation lists. While GM resumed vehicle assembly just 11 days after the disaster, 122 finished and in-process Corvettes inside the facility were written off due to potential smoke and structural heat exposure. Five years later, former dismantler Brandon Woodley spoke with The Drive about the secretive demolition operation that followed. 8

The brand-new sports cars arrived on commercial vehicle haulers at Stricker Auto Parts in Batavia, Ohio, appearing to salvage yard workers as pristine showroom inventory rather than collision wrecks. Because of corporate liability policies and manufacturer destruction mandates, GM required the recycler to remove every vehicle identification number plate from the body shells and physically slice each composite chassis in half with industrial saws to prevent anyone from rebuilding the cars. 8
Woodley and his colleagues drained all vehicle fluids, removed individual 6.2-liter LT2 V-8 engines, dual-clutch transaxles, and mechanical subsystems, and tagged the assemblies for return to General Motors. In response to inquiries from The Drive, General Motors confirmed that all tornado-damaged vehicles were completely scrapped, stating that no salvaged components from the Batavia operation were reused in subsequent customer production builds. 8
